The federal government  developed the Employee Retention Credit (ERC) to  offer a refundable  work tax credit to help  organizations with the  price of keeping staff employed.

Qualified businesses that experienced a decrease in gross receipts or were closed as a result of government order and also really did not claim the credit when they submitted their initial return can take advantage by filing adjusted employment tax returns. For instance, companies that file quarterly work income tax return can file Form 941 X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for RefundPDF, to claim the credit for previous 2020 as well as 2021 quarters. Can you use PPP loan to start a business.

With the exemption of a recoverystartup business, many taxpayers ended up being disqualified to claim the ERC for incomes paid after September 30, 2021. A recovery start-up business can still claim the ERC for incomes paid after June 30, 2021, as well as before January 1, 2022.

What Are Qualified Wages?

What counts as qualified  earnings  relies on the size of your business and  the number of  workers you  carry  personnel. There’s no  dimension limit to be eligible for the ERC, but  little  and also large  business are  discriminated.

For 2020, if you had greater than 100 full time employees in 2019, you can only claim the earnings of workers you retained yet were not working. If you have fewer than 100 staff members, you can claim everybody, whether they were working or not.

For 2021, the threshold was elevated to having 500 full time employees in 2019, providing companies a whole lot extra leeway as to who they can claim for the credit. Can you use PPP loan to start a business.  Any type of wages that are based on FICA taxes Qualify, as well as you can consist of qualified health and wellness expenses when computing the tax credit.

This income has to have been paid between March 13, 2020, and also September 30, 2021. Nonetheless, recovery start-up organizations have to claim the credit through completion of 2021.
